First things first, make yourself a tupperdor to hold your non infused sticks for the time being so you don't have any of the infused smokes' flavors running into traditional cigars. You'll want separate humidors for infused/flavored smokes and traditional cigars.
And personally, I'd smoke the LGC Serie R, but thats because I love any good earthy sticks, especially ones with a good sweetness to them like the Serie R.
Oh, and samplers definitely, try to get a good smattering of the tried and trues(Fuente, Padron, Pepin, Rocky Patel, Oliva, etc.) and narrow down what you like best. Then start trying some of the more "boutique" blends out there based on your tastes.
